Tartempion   10 #2 Posted February 25, 2006 Hi  Does anyone know how I can get music to play on my myspace page? I've downloaded a song from Itunes that I'd like to use but am not sure if I need to insert some XHTML code somewhere or something.  I found a myspace editor which I used to create a code for the background, colours and so on but it doesn't tell me about music. mr chris   10 #3 Posted February 25, 2006 If you've downloaded it from iTunes, then chances are it won't work. iTunes default format is .m4a (.m4p if you've download it - the p means it's a protected file).  iTunes will convert .m4a tracks to mp3 but it won't convert .m4p (as you have to pay for them). Tartempion   10 #7 Posted May 2, 2006 If I want to leave a comment containing a picture on a friend's board, how do I get the pic in? I've done it before but I can't remember. The pic I want is just one I have saved on my computer. I tried copying and pasting but that didn't work. Any clues from the more technically minded among you? mr chris   10 #8 Posted May 3, 2006 The picture would need to already be online (if it's not, the find somewhere you can upload it to, like flickr or photobucket). To insert it. type <img src="http://the full address of the picture you want to include">  That's the simple answer.
